Breach & Clear looks to finally be released onto Android on September 5th

This upcoming Thursday is starting to look real good in terms of game releases on Android. The newest one to make the list is the tactical squad-based strategy game Breach & Clear which we ave been following since we found out about it. Originally this game was going to be free-to-play but the developers did not want the game mechanics and fun to be ruin so they switched to making the game a full paid title instead.

Breach & Clear is a tactical warfare game with highly details 3D visuals and some pretty entertaining looking gameplay that Robert Bowling, Gun Media and Mighty Rabbit are working on. In this game players will be controlling a squad of four special ops soldiers through different infiltration missions that have different objectives to complete.

The upcoming Android version will feature a ton of new content as well:

New Missions – Gamers can take their elite special operations team to Freiburg, Germany in a new twist on Breach and Clear. Missions range from open forested areas to mysterious compounds where entirely new enemies await.

New Enemies – The Android launch will see the rise of more dangerous enemies, forcing special operations teams to encounter deadly snipers, heavy armored units, and speed rushers armed with shotguns!

Bomb Defusal – The launch of Android will also mark the inclusion of the first new game mode; bomb defusal. Players will be tasked with locating and defusing bombs within a certain time limit, all while fighting off continuous waves of enemies.

To round everything off, when the game does land on Google Play this September 5th, 2013, you will be able to pick it up on sale to celebrate the game’s launch for $1.99 which is $2 off the game’s regular price.
